The Fluctuating Value of Bitcoin

Before we dive into the current exchange rate, it's essential to understand that Bitcoin's value is highly volatile. The cryptocurrency's price can fluctuate rapidly due to various market and economic factors, such as supply and demand, government regulations, and global events. This volatility means that the value of 1 Bitcoin in Pakistani Rupees can change rapidly.

Why Bitcoin is Gaining Popularity in Pakistan

Pakistan has seen a significant increase in Bitcoin adoption in recent years. This can be attributed to several factors, including:

  • Remittances: Bitcoin offers a convenient and cost-effective way for overseas Pakistanis to send money back home.
  • investment: With its high returns, Bitcoin has become an attractive investment option for many Pakistanis.
  • E-commerce: Online businesses in Pakistan are starting to accept Bitcoin as a form of payment, making it easier for consumers to make transactions.
